Georgia 3CCT LED Pendant from Access Lighting Offers True-to-Life Color Rendering

Access Lighting Georgia

The Georgia 3CCT LED Pendant from Access Lighting combines style and functionality, in sleek chrome and elegant antique brushed steel finishes. The 4” diameter crystal glass diffuser adds a touch of sophistication, creating a stunning circular light pattern on your workspace.

With high 90 CRI, Georgia ensures vibrant, true-to-life color rendering for any setting. Equipped with a 3-CCT Selectable Switch, Georgia offers customizable lighting with 3000K, 3500K, and 4000K options. Operating at just 8W, it delivers 500 nominal lumens for energy-efficient performance.

For added versatility, Georgia is supplied with 10 feet of cord and three down rod options (6”, 16”, and 22”) to accommodate a variety of mounting needs. Damp-rated and JA8/Title 24 listed, this pendant meets the highest standards for performance and compliance.
